HIRING PEOPLE seeks mechanical engineering graduates for a three-year programme based in Erskine, Scotland. The role offers a base salary of £33k, potentially rising to £60k with additional site uplifts. You will work in diverse environments, requiring hands-on engineering skills with significant travel involved.
The programme emphasizes skill development and on-site experience, with a structured pathway leading to various specialisms. Ideal candidates possess a strong engineering background and a willingness to engage in practical work from day one.

How to prepare for a job interview at Hiring People
✨Know Your Engineering Basics
Brush up on your mechanical engineering fundamentals before the interview. Be ready to discuss key concepts and how they apply to hands-on machining. This shows your passion for the field and that you're prepared to dive into practical work.
✨Showcase Your Hands-On Experience
Prepare examples of any hands-on projects or experiences you've had during your studies or internships. Whether it's a university project or a personal endeavour, being able to talk about your practical skills will impress the interviewers.
✨Research the Company Culture
Understand HIRING PEOPLE's values and work environment. Tailor your responses to reflect how you align with their emphasis on skill development and teamwork. This will demonstrate that you're not just looking for any job, but that you're genuinely interested in contributing to their team.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the programme and the types of projects you'll be involved in. This shows your enthusiasm for the role and helps you gauge if the position is the right fit for you. Plus, it gives you a chance to engage with the interviewers on a deeper level.
